Born in Sherman, Texas, Reeves grew up in Austin while his father was a member of the state legislature. In the 1920s, he voluntarily adopted the life of a hobo, writing and singing songs as he traveled. He began recording his music in 1929, and became known as "the Texas Drifter" the year after that. (This was not his only stage name; he also sometimes billed himself as "George Riley, the Yodeling Rustler," and "the Broadway Wrangler.")

A sampling of the Texas Drifter's recordings can be found on the third CD of a four-CD set released in 2005, Sounds Like Jimmie Rodgers--on which Reeves sings 19 songs.

An earlier (1994) CD release entitled Hobo's Lullaby has Goebel Reeves singing on all 26 tracks, 16 of which are not duplicated on the 2005 Sounds Like Jimmie Rodgers CD.
